Bayer Leverkusen brutally criticize Arsenal as Granit Xhaka’s transfer is confirmed shortly after their title loss

May 19, 2024No Comments2 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Telegram Email WhatsApp Copy Link

Arsenal’s title hopes were dashed on the final day of the Premier League season when Manchester City clinched the trophy with a win over West Ham, despite Arsenal’s victory over Everton. German side Bayer Leverkusen, who celebrated winning the Bundesliga, took to social media to tease Arsenal about their disappointment by posting an image of Granit Xhaka with the trophy. Xhaka, a former Arsenal player, played a key role in Leverkusen’s season, contributing to their unbeaten run.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ta congratulated Xhaka and Leverkusen on their success.

The Gunners’ new shirt design, created by Adidas, features a minimalistic and modern look that pays homage to Arsenal’s heritage, with an elegant canon design on the front. Xhaka’s success with Leverkusen highlights the difference in Arsenal’s season, which saw them finish as runners-up despite their efforts on the final day. Leverkusen’s unbeaten league campaign and upcoming matches in the German Cup and Europa Conference League finals put them in a strong position to potentially add more silverware to their collection. Xhaka expressed his joy at the team’s achievements and their desire to continue winning trophies.

Xhaka’s performance in Leverkusen has been impressive, with 48 appearances and three goals in his debut season. Arsenal sent their best wishes to Xhaka after their title hopes were dashed, showing their support for their former player. Leverkusen’s coach, Xabi Alonso, was also praised by Arteta for his team’s success. Leverkusen’s strong season and potential for further victories highlight the stark contrast to Arsenal’s near-miss in the Premier League title race.
